SUMMARY

Responsible for the overall repair and maintenance of all electrical and mechanical slot machines under the direction of the Slot Technician Supervisor or Slot Shift Supervisor. 

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Responsible for the repair, overhaul, and proper preventative maintenance of all electrical and mechanical slot machines in accordance with gaming regulations.
  • Will abide by all Menominee Casino Resort Policies and Procedures, Slot Department Procedures as outlined in the Slot Handbooks and the Gaming Standards set forth by the Slot Department and Gaming Commission.
  • Regularly practice the (5) five basic service standards established by the Menominee Casino Resort.
  • Run no communication and door status reports and repair problems daily.
  • Log machines that are troublesome to fix on the Machine Problems sheet with complete explanation of the problem.
  • Ensures the continuous operation of slot machines on the gaming floor by troubleshooting and correcting any issues.
  • Help perform Machine Attendant functions when needed including removing jams and filling e-ticket paper.
  • Train and function as a mentor for new Slot Department Employees.
  • Maintain records of all machine repairs and maintenance through proper paperwork trail.
  • Help maintain an inventory of parts for all slot machines by logging every part taken out of inventory and any parts that need to be ordered or repaired by the Bench Technician.
  • Work with the floor personnel to resolve guest questions related to payout and operation of machines and bring disputes and unusual customer activities to the attention of the Slot Supervisor.
  • Use any company property in a responsible manner and keep the Slot Technician shop clean, neat and organized.
  • May assist the Senior Slot Technicians with installations, conversions, moves or any other scheduled or non-scheduled slot projects.
  • May assist in ensuring machine integrity when jackpots occur and at other times requested.
  • Promotes positive Customer Relations through prompt, courteous and efficient service.
  • Responsible for maintaining a consistent, regular attendance record with occasional weekends, evenings or holidays required.
  • Attendance at workshops, seminars and monthly staff meetings are required.
  • Provide proper slot machine “Eye” coverage and assist co-workers when needed.
  • Help keep the gaming floor sections free of debris, including emptying ash trays and pushing in chairs.
  • Perform any other duties as assigned by immediate supervisor.
